LOCKE, NY (607NewsNow) – A wanted Cayuga County man is in custody.
On January 22, members of the Cortland County Sheriff’s Office initiated a traffic stop.
Deputies discovered the driver, Theodore Strauf, of Locke, had an outstanding arrest warrant in Cayuga County. On November 14, 2025, authorities were called to an address in the Town of Locke for a report of a person with a gun. The 56-year-old Strauf, who had left before police arrived, is accused of possessing the weapon while having a previous felony conviction.
Strauf is charged with felony criminal possession of a weapon as a convicted felon.
Strauf was turned over to the Cayuga County Sheriff’s Office for arraignment. He’s scheduled to appear in Locke Town Court on February 4.
